As an eyewitness noted, at the time of the shooting, he passed along Baranov Street.

“I walked along the street, I hear pops. Well, like firecrackers, three or four pops. I see a man rushing out, running straight. And after him - the shooter. And the shooter hits straight at the man, and the man falls near the yellow car. I ran to the man to see whether he was alive or not, then I looked around, and near the white car a woman in a semi-squat. She had a wounded knee, and she asked me for help, begging me to come, ”the New Kaliningrad Internet portal quotes the student.

He noted that he could not approach the woman to help her, because he heard the next shots.

“I hear - a shot in the air from behind from behind. Then he heard another shot and ran back. I look around ... and I see that the woman at the car is already dead. After two or three seconds, I hear another shot - it’s the attacker who has already tried to commit suicide, ”said the student.

According to the student, he ran to the shooter and grabbed his weapon from him, holding the man at gunpoint, walked away, and after about a minute, upon the arrival of the Russian Guard, put down his weapon and left the scene.

Earlier it became known that a 13-year-old teenager who was injured while shooting in the center of Kaliningrad, where his parents also died, was discharged from the hospital.

On Saturday, February 15, in Kaliningrad, a man and a woman were killed in the central market in shooting.

The man who opened fire on passers-by died in the hospital.

The UK instituted proceedings after the incident.
